Care and Maintenance

SOME IMPORTANT RULES FOR THE CORRECT USE OF THE
FREEZER

• Never place hot foods in the freezer.

• Never place spoiled foods in the unit.

• Don’t overload the unit.

• Don’t open the lid unless necessary.

• Should the freezer be stored without use for long periods, it is sug-

gested, after a careful cleaning, to leave the lid open to allow the air
to circulate inside the unit in order to avoid the possibility of
condensation, mold or odors.

Troubleshooting

Occasionally, a minor problem may arise, and a service call may not be necessary- use this troubleshooting guide for a
possible solution. If the unit continues to operate improperly, call an authorized service depot or Danby’s Toll Free
Number
for assistance.
